Securing Classical IP Over ATM Networks

Carsten Benecke and Uwe Ellermann, Universität Hamburg

This paper discusses some security issues of `Classical IP over ATM' networks. After analyzing new threats to IP networks based on ATM, security mechanisms to protect these networks are introduced. The integration of firewalls into ATM networks requires additional considerations. We conclude that careful configuration of ATM switches and ATM services can provide some level of protection against spoofing and denial of service attacks. Our solutions are intended to be applied to current IP over ATM networks and do not require any changes to these protocols or additions to current switch capabilities.
